摘要
The H-lattice is a geometric model for describing the construction and occupied configuration of the hypercube multiprocessors. Besides, it can well-model the faulty hypercube in tile presence of faulty processors and/or links. The H-lattice scheme, based on this model, can allocate fault-free subcubes for various allocations, such as first-/best-/worst-/next-fit, and subcube inclusion/exclusion allocations, in a more simple and efficient manner than ever. In this scheme, tile viewpoint of the minimum destroyed degree is introduced to select the best-fit subcube, which is proved to be better than that of other schemes. Mathematical analyses and simulation are also derived to demonstrate the efficiency of the proposed scheme.
